Reversing contactor assembly — two 3RT2016-2FB42 contactors in one package
The Siemens 3RA2316-8XB30-2FB4 is a SIRIUS reversing contactor assembly built from two 3RT2016-2FB42 contactors, mechanically and electrically interlocked for forward/reverse motor control. It saves panel space versus wiring two separate contactors and avoids the risk of both coils pulling in simultaneously. The 24 VDC coil (spring-type terminals) pulls in reliably across the operating range of -25 to +60 °C, and the assembly manages 750 switching cycles per hour in AC-3 and AC-3e duty.
Spring terminals and DIN-rail mounting — no screw torque to check
No screw terminals to retorque after thermal cycling, which saves a step during panel commissioning and maintenance. Fastens onto 35 mm DIN rail with screw or snap-on mounting. Dimensions are 90 mm wide × 84 mm high × 83 mm deep (size S00 contactor frame). The required clearance around the assembly: 6 mm upwards, forwards, downwards, and to the side; 0 mm backwards — so it can sit flush against the back panel.
